    Gasmet - committed to producing high quality monitoring technology

    Over the last three decades Gasmet has evolved from a university spin-off into a global supplier and manufacturer of gas analysis systems through its commitment to improving air quality, protecting the environment and promoting work safety.

    In 1990, Finnish shelter and blast resistant and gastight door manufacturer Finntemet acquired the Fourier Transform Infrared spectroscopy or FTIR business of Scanoptics and Temet Instruments – which later became Gasmet – was born.

    The first FTIR gas analyser was sold in 1993 and the range of applications for the technology saw business expand across Europe and into the US. In the following decade a management buyout was completed and the company was renamed Gasmet Technologies in 2006.

    Gasmet is now one of the leading providers of certified continuous emission monitoring solutions for crucial gas compounds worldwide with in excess of 5000 devices in use across more than 80 countries.

    Portfolio of innovative solutions

    Despite the presence of modern and efficient industrial gas purification systems, industrial plants may discharge small amounts of pollutants that are harmful to humans and the environment. Gasmet’s continuous emission monitoring systems help maintain these emissions at a safe level.

    The company has developed a portfolio of innovative solutions, including a continuous emission monitoring system (CEMS); a continuous mercury monitoring system (CMM); and a system for dioxin sampling (GT90 Dioxin+).

    All Gasmet systems are certified according to EN 15267. Further information on certification can be found on Gasmet’s Certificates-page.
